body 
{
	margin:0px; 
	padding:0px; 
	background:#f1eded;
}
#headerbanner03-noimage 
{
	background:url(../images/header04-noimage.gif) top center no-repeat;
	height:22px;
}
#contentbg01-noimage
 {
	background:url(../images/contentbg04-noimage.gif) top center no-repeat;
}
#contentbg02-noimage
 {
	background:url(../images/contentbg0401-noimage.gif) top center repeat-y;
}

#mainpage {
	width:820px;
	margin-left:auto;
	margin-right:auto;
	padding:0px;
	padding:0px;
	border:#cc0000 solid 0px;
}
#headerbanner{
	width:820px;
	height:14px;
	background:url(../images/pagelayout01top.png) top center no-repeat;
}
#contentmid
{
	width:820px;
	background:url(../images/pagelayout01mid.png) top center repeat-y;
}
.bodycontent {
	width:760px;
	margin-left:20px;
	margin-right:20px;
	border:#005500 solid 0px;
}
#footer 
{
	width:820px;
	height:86px;
	color:#ffffff;
	font-family: arial, Helvetica, sans-serif;
	font-size: 10px;
	vertical-align:top;
	text-align: right;
	background:url(../images/pagelayout01footer.png) top center no-repeat;
}
#footercontent 
{
	width:800px;
	padding-top:15px;
	color:#ffffff;
	font-size:8pt;
	text-align:center;
	margin-left:auto;
	margin-right:auto;
	border:#005500 solid 0px;
}
#footercontent a:link
 {
	color:#ffffff;
	font-family: arial, Helvetica, sans-serif;
	text-decoration: none;
	font-size: 10px;
}
#footercontent a:visited 
{
	color:#ffffff;
	font-family: arial, Helvetica, sans-serif;
	text-decoration: none;
	font-size: 10px;
}
#footercontent a:active 
{
	color:#ffffff;
	font-family: arial, Helvetica, sans-serif;
	text-decoration: none;
	font-size: 10px;
}
#footercontent a:hover 
{
	color:#df0024;
	font-family: arial, Helvetica, sans-serif;
	text-decoration: none;
	font-size: 10px;
	background-color: #ffffff;
}

.clear { clear: both; }
.red { color: #c00; }
.blue { color: blue; }
.teal
{
	font-size: 14pt;
	line-height: 14pt;
	color: teal;
	font-weight: bold;
	font-family: Arial, Helvetica, sans-serif;
}
div.MsoNormal 
{
	mso-style-unhide:no;
	mso-style-qformat:yes;
	mso-style-parent:"";
	margin:0cm;
	margin-bottom:.0001pt;
	mso-pagination:widow-orphan;
	font-size:12.0pt;
	font-family:"Times New Roman","serif";
	mso-fareast-font-family:"Times New Roman";
}
li.MsoNormal
 {
	mso-style-unhide:no;
	mso-style-qformat:yes;
	mso-style-parent:"";
	margin:0cm;
	margin-bottom:.0001pt;
	mso-pagination:widow-orphan;
	font-size:12.0pt;
	font-family:"Times New Roman","serif";
	mso-fareast-font-family:"Times New Roman";
}
p.MsoNormal
 {
	mso-style-unhide:no;
	mso-style-qformat:yes;
	mso-style-parent:"";
	margin:0cm;
	margin-bottom:.0001pt;
	mso-pagination:widow-orphan;
	font-size:12.0pt;
	font-family:"Times New Roman","serif";
	mso-fareast-font-family:"Times New Roman";
}